Optical Cable Materials

Optical cables are primarily made of glass or plastic fibers, surrounded by protective coatings, buffer layers, and jackets to ensure signal integrity and durability.Core and CladdingThe core is the central part of the optical fiber through which light travels. It is typically made from ultra-pure silica glass (SiO₂), sometimes doped with germanium to control the refractive index for efficient light transmission. Plastic cores are also used for short-range applications. Surrounding the core is the cladding, made from a material with a slightly lower refractive index than the core, which ensures total internal reflection and guides light along the fiber .Coatings and Buffer LayersTo protect the delicate fiber, a dual-layer UV-cured acrylate coating is applied: a soft primary layer cushions the fiber, while a hard secondary layer provides mechanical protection. Additional buffer layers or tubes made of tough resin or polymer encase the coated fibers, preventing damage during handling and installation .Strength MembersOptical cables include strength members such as aramid yarn (Kevlar), fiberglass rods, or steel wires to provide tensile strength and prevent stretching, especially in outdoor or long-distance installations .Jackets and SheathingThe outer jacket protects the cable from environmental factors like moisture, UV radiation, and chemicals. Common materials include polyethylene (PE), polyvinyl chloride (PVC), or low-smoke zero-halogen (LSZH) compounds. Armored cables may include metallic layers for additional protection and grounding .Specialized MaterialsSome optical cables incorporate water-blocking gels or tapes, ribbons with UV-curable resin, or micro-additives like glass flakes and borates to enhance performance in specific conditions. Hollow-core fibers, where light travels through air, are used for ultra-low latency and high-speed applications .Types of Optical FibersSingle-mode fiber (SMF): Small core (≈8–10 µm), ideal for long-distance, high-bandwidth communication.Multimode fiber (MMF): Larger core (50–62.5 µm), suitable for short-range applications like campus networks . In summary, optical cables combine high-purity glass or plastic fibers with protective coatings, buffer layers, strength members, and jackets to ensure reliable, high-speed data transmission across various environments and distances.
